September 26, 2011 - College Summit Launches New College-Going Culture Initiative for K-8 in New Haven

New Haven Promise announced the full launch of “Pathway to Promise,” a new preK-8 college-focused initiative created in partnership with College Summit. Pathway to Promise, coupled with the expansion of College Summit in additional New Haven high schools, creates a comprehensive preK-12 college-going program designed to ensure that students hear about college early and often.     

College Summit developed a set of K-8 supports for the partnership, including age-appropriate goals, milestones and suggested activities for students in grades K-8.   Through this new initiative, students in all elementary and middle school classrooms will master core understandings and embark on their yearlong journey toward future success.
